Location
On S side of minor road about 2km SSW of Caio church, about 700m to E of junction of B4302 and A482.
History
Probably early-to-mid C19
Exterior
House. Single-storey. Corrugated roof covering; end chimney stacks. Roughcast symmetrical front, with central doorway (C20 panelled door), square 4-pane window to each side (shallow moulded hoods over openings). Sides and rear in rubble (painted). To L, former byre under corrugated sheet roof; end doorway. Small corrugated lean-to (R). Rear has full width stone outshut with slated and felted roof.
Interior
Said to have 2 rooms with kitchen in outshut; hardboard ceilings, boarded walls. Some lath and plaster visible. Victorian cast iron fireplaces, boarded doors.
Byre said to have exposed collared roof trusses; extensive areas of straw thatch mixed with gorse. Intermediate loft floor supported on beams with wide floor boards. Crude timber planked partition.
Reason for designation
A building in local vernacular tradition, retaining much overall character.
